Manufacturer · Selangor Industrial Zone

Demand-Driven Supply Planning

CHALLENGE

A mid-sized electronics component manufacturer was experiencing persistent overstock on slow-moving SKUs while simultaneously running short on high-velocity items. Their planning team was spending significant time on manual adjustments with limited visibility into upstream demand.

SOLUTION

Deepfield implemented a demand sensing model drawing from POS data, order history, and seasonal signals. Inventory policies were redesigned by SKU category, and the model was integrated into their SAP ERP environment. The engagement ran over 14 weeks including a full validation phase.

RESULTS

  • Inventory holding costs reduced by 23%
  • Stockout frequency down by around 40%
  • Planning cycle time cut from 3 days to under 6 hours
  • ERP integration live within 10 weeks

3PL Operator · Peninsular Malaysia

Logistics Route Optimisation

CHALLENGE

A third-party logistics provider managing 60+ vehicles across Peninsular Malaysia was relying on dispatcher experience for route planning. Delivery windows were frequently missed, fuel costs were above sector benchmarks, and the operations team had no structured way to evaluate routing decisions.

SOLUTION

Deepfield conducted geospatial analysis of delivery zones, modelled operational constraints including time windows, vehicle weight limits, and driver regulations, and developed a route optimisation engine. A web-based operations dashboard was deployed for daily scheduling use.

RESULTS

  • Average route distance reduced by 18%
  • On-time delivery rate improved to 94%
  • Fuel expenditure down approximately 15%
  • Dispatcher workload reduced noticeably

FMCG Distributor · Klang Valley

Supply Chain Visibility Platform

CHALLENGE

A fast-moving consumer goods distributor was operating across procurement, warehousing, and outbound logistics with data sitting in separate systems. Their management team had no consolidated view of operations, and disruptions were typically identified after they had already caused delays.

SOLUTION

Deepfield designed and deployed a visibility platform connecting procurement data, warehouse management output, and logistics tracking feeds. The platform includes real-time status monitoring, predictive alerting for potential disruptions, and bottleneck identification across the supply chain. Delivered over 12 weeks.

RESULTS

  • 3 data silos unified into one dashboard
  • Disruption response time reduced by ~55%
  • Management reporting time cut significantly
  • Early warning alerts active across all channels
